Richard B. Gasaway

Richard B. Gasaway, PhD, has served more than 30 years as a public safety professional in six emergency service organizations. Before retiring in 2009, he held the positions of firefighter, EMT-paramedic, lieutenant, captain, training officer, assistant chief and fire chief.

In addition to his lifelong commitment of service to others, Dr. Gasaway has a second passion: understanding how the brain works and relaying those lessons in meaningful ways for the benefit of first responders.

He is widely considered to be one of the nation's foremost authorities on first responder decision making and situational awareness under stress. His programs on situational awareness and decision making have been presented more than 2,500 times to some 30,000 first responders and business professionals worldwide. He has contributed to more than 350 journal and website articles, books, and book chapters on the topics of first responder leadership and safety.
